Tell us about your move

Create your Arrival account and enter your new address, move-in date, and any preferences — broadband speed requirements, whether you want a smart meter, your council tax band if you know it. The whole process takes about five minutes.

We contact suppliers on your behalf

Arrival registers your electricity and gas with an appropriate supplier, arranges broadband installation, notifies the council for your council tax, and sets up your water account — all before your move-in date. You receive email confirmation and reference numbers for every account.

One monthly direct debit

Once set up, all five utilities are billed through a single direct debit on a date you choose. Your Arrival account shows each bill, tracks your usage, and lets you update any supplier detail in one place.

Setup timeline

When things happen

Most accounts are live by your move-in date. Here's a rough timeline from when you sign up.

Day 0

You sign up

5 minutes. Address, date, preferences.

Days 1–3

Supplier registrations submitted

Energy, water, and council tax notifications go out. Broadband appointment booked.

Days 5–10

Confirmations arrive

Reference numbers and confirmation letters from each supplier land in your Arrival account and by post.

Move-in

Keys, not admin

Electricity, gas, water, and broadband are all live. First direct debit collects on your chosen date.

No. Arrival acts as an intermediary and handles all supplier contact on your behalf. You give us authority to register accounts in your name, and we do the rest. You will receive confirmation from each supplier directly.

We arrange broadband through the providers available at your specific address — which depends on the infrastructure in your area. We'll tell you your options during setup and book the installation appointment once you confirm.

You can specify a preferred energy supplier during setup and we'll do our best to arrange with them. Council tax and water are fixed to your area and can't be switched, but we handle registration with the correct authorities automatically.

We recommend signing up at least 10 days before your move-in date, ideally two weeks. This gives time for supplier registration, broadband appointments, and council tax notifications to complete.

Yes. One person sets up the Arrival account and takes responsibility for the direct debit. Your housemates can be added as additional occupants for council tax purposes. How you split costs between yourselves is entirely up to you.

With Arrival Plus, move-out utility closure is one click. We notify all suppliers of your end date, request final readings, and handle direct debit cancellation. Basic users can manage this manually through their account. See our move-out checklist for guidance.
